Step-by-step instructions: how to recover lost numbers

The procedure for restoring license plates in 2026 takes from 1 to 5 days and consists of three stages:

  1. Filing a claim for loss (to the police or through State Services).
  2. Getting new numbers at the traffic police or MFC.
  3. Installation and registration signs (if necessary).

Let's look at each stage in detail.

1. Application for loss of numbers

First you need to officially record the fact of loss. This will protect you from possible problems if the numbers are used by scammers (for example, to commit crimes). You can do this in two ways:

  • 📝 Contact the nearest police station (any, not necessarily at the place of registration of the vehicle). Write a statement of loss according to the sample, you will be given a notification coupon.
  • 💻 Submit an application through State Services (section “Loss of registration plates”). You will need to attach scans of your PTS and passport.

Application review period: 1 working day. After this, you will receive a notification about registration of the fact of loss.

2. Obtaining new numbers

After registering the loss, you can order duplicates. To do this:

  1. Pay the state fee - 800₽ for each sign (possible with a 30% discount through State Services).
  2. Make an appointment at the traffic police or MFC (through State Services or by phone).
  3. Come to the selected branch with documents (see checklist above).

New numbers will be produced within 1–3 hours (if there is no queue). You will be given signs with the same letters and numbers, which were previously, but with new protective markings. If the old license plates are found later, they will have to be handed over to the traffic police - they will not be able to be used.

3. Installation and registration

After receiving new license plates, they must be installed on the car within 10 days. If you don’t make it in time, the inspector may issue a fine for “failure to fulfill obligations to register a vehicle” (Part 1 of Article 12.1 of the Administrative Code - 500–800 rubles).

Installation Features:

  • 🔧 Pin the signs only standard fasteners (screws, rivets). The use of plastic ties or tape is equivalent to “unreadable numbers” (fine 500 RUR).
  • 📏 The distance between the signs and the body must be at least 1 cm (so as not to complicate identification).
  • 🎨 It is prohibited to apply any coatings to the numbers (even “protective” films), change the color or font.

1. Temporary registration plate

Transit numbers are issued for up to 20 days and allow you to drive legally without major signs. To receive them:

  1. Submit an application to the traffic police (possibly through State Services).
  2. Pay the state fee - 1600₽ (for two characters).
  3. Receive transits on the same day.

Please note: transit numbers not tied to your car. They can be used on any vehicle, but only for driving. If the inspector sees that you travel with transit for more than 20 days or use them for other purposes, the fine will be 5000₽.

What happens if you drive without license plates: fines and consequences

Violation of the vehicle registration rules is punishable under two articles of the Administrative Code:

Violation Article of the Administrative Code Fine/punishment Additional measures
One or both license plates are missing Part 2 Art. 12.2 5000₽ or deprivation of rights for 1–3 months Evacuation to impound lot
Numbers are set incorrectly (unreadable, closed, changed) Part 1 Art. 12.2 500₽ Requirement to eliminate the violation on the spot
Using someone else's or fake numbers Part 3 Art. 12.2 Deprivation of rights for 6–12 months Criminal liability (Article 327 of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ation)
Failure to install numbers within 10 days after receipt Part 1 Art. 12.1 500–800₽

The most unpleasant consequence is evacuation to impound lot. According to Part 1 of Art. 27.13 of the Administrative Code, a car without license plates can be taken to a special parking lot if:

  • 🚔 The driver cannot present documents for reinstatement.
  • 📄 Numbers are no longer available 24 hours (considered deliberate evasion).
  • 🔍 There is a suspicion that the car is wanted or has fake signs.

The cost of evacuation and storage at impound lots in Moscow and St. Petersburg reaches 10,000₽ per day. In the regions - about 3000-5000 rubles.

Frequently asked questions about lost numbers

Is it possible to drive if I have lost only the front or only the rear license plate?

No, this equates to no numbers. Fine - 5000 rubles (part 2 of article 12.2 of the Code of Administrative Offenses). Exception: if you are transporting the car on a tow truck or towing.

What to do if the numbers were stolen (and not lost yourself)?

First, write a statement to the police about the theft (under Article 158 of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ation). Then restore the signs through the traffic police. If the stolen license plates are found on another car, you will be acquitted of all fines that will be imposed on them.

How much does it cost to restore numbers in 2026?

The state duty for one sign is 800₽ (1600₽ for both). Through State Services there is a 30% discount (560₽ per sign). Transit numbers cost 1600₽ (without discount).

Can they issue a fine if the license plates are lost along the way (for example, they fell off)?

Yes, the inspector has the right. But if you prove that the signs have fallen off just now (for example, show traces of fastenings or witnesses), the fine may be replaced with a warning.

What will happen if the numbers are not restored at all?

In addition to fines for driving without license plates, you may deprive of rights for systematic violation (part 2 of article 12.2 of the Code of Administrative Offenses). There is also a risk that the stolen car will be registered as yours if fraudsters use your old license plates.

Life hacks: how to avoid losing numbers in the future

To avoid encountering the problem again, follow these simple tips:

  • 🔩 Use anti-vandal bolts for attaching license plates (cost 200–500₽, but protect against theft).
  • 🔧 Check the fastenings once a month - over time, the screws become loose due to vibration.
  • 📸 Take a photo of the numbers and save the photo in the cloud (useful for reporting loss).
  • 🚨 Install GPS tracker per car (for example, StarLine M17 or Pandora). Some models notify you if someone tries to rent a number.

If you live in a region with bad roads (for example, in Siberia or the Far East), additionally protect your license plates transparent silicone case. It will prevent dirt from getting into the mounts and reduce vibration.
